Source Coffeehouse, Bridgeport

What Makes It "Strong": The coffee at this two-year-old cozy cafe is "ethically sourced" from Passenger Coffee Roasters. Source only serves fair trade teas and sugar. Pour-overs are popular (basically a manuel brew of the best beans) as are its baked in-house goodies. 

Husband and wife Owners Courtney and Matthew Hartl are all about community and using local ingredients whenever possible, including honey from Red Bee in Weston, bread from Fairfield Bread Company and milk from Connecticut farmers.
